  • Publication number: 20120012134
    Abstract: A resist on an electronic material is surely separated and removed in a short time. The electronic material is cleaned with a sulfuric acid solution containing persulfuric acid to separate and clean the resist, and thereafter wet cleaning is performed with gas dissolved water. By using gas dissolved water for performing wet cleaning after the resist separation with the sulfuric acid solution containing persulfuric acid, the time required for cleaning can be sharply reduced as compared with that of a former method. The sulfuric acid solution containing persulfuric acid is preferably one produced by electrolyzing a sulfuric acid solution.

  • Publication number: 20050093182
    Abstract: An apparatus for continuous dissolution comprising a dissolution portion for dissolving a gas into a main stream liquid, which comprises a flow meter measuring the flow rate of the main stream liquid and outputting a signal of the value obtained by the measurement and a mechanism for controlling the flow rate which controls the amount of supply of the gas based on the input signal; and a process for continuously dissolving a gas into the main stream liquid, wherein the amount of the gas is controlled based on the flow rate of the main stream liquid. Since a solution having a constant concentration can be obtained with stability even when the flow rate of the main stream liquid changes, cleaning water or surface treatment water used for electronic materials which particularly require a precisely clean surface can be supplied without loss.
